The payment wall barrier

There is a hidden hurdle that many Italian shoppers encounter when they try to check out on high-end US websites. Popular brands and retailers frequently employ strict security filters that block international credit cards or payments from outside the United States. You might find the perfect 2026 Heritage Edition in stock, enter your Italian Visa or Mastercard, only to have the order cancelled five minutes later.

This happens because these stores often prioritize domestic orders and use automated systems to flag any billing address that doesn't match a US zip code. It can be incredibly frustrating to see a great deal and be unable to pay for it.

Managing Italian import costs

When the jacket arrives in Italy, it will be subject to local regulations. It is important to be aware of the import duties and VAT that the Italian Customs Agency (Agenzia delle Dogane) will apply. Generally, for high-value apparel like a Filson jacket, you should expect to pay the standard Italian VAT of 22% plus any applicable duties.

Even with these customs tax additions, the total price often remains hundreds of Euros cheaper than buying the same jacket from a retailer in Milan.
